    Description / Table of Contents: Thermal aging and endurance of organic insulating materials. The knowledge of the thermal endurance of organic insulating materials is very important for the application in electrical engineering. The change of the values of the properties by thermal aging is, theoretically, described under the assumption being a linear connection to the rules of the kinetic theory of chemical reactions. By this premise it is possible to indicate functions for aging and thermal endurance, being plotted as straight lines in suitable coordinates. In this way the test results can be evaluated better than by conventional means.

    Description / Table of Contents: Gold Flashing on Relay Contacts. It is not the colour but the resistance of contacts which determines their efficiency. Since, however, it is an expensive and time-wasting procedure to measure the resistance of every contact, many costomers reject relays whose silver contacts show a brownish-black discolouration, complaining that they have been kept too long in stock.This problem was believed to have been solved by the introduction of gold-flashing as a temporary coating while the contacts are kept in stock. Now the German Post Office's Telecommunications Head Quarters (Fernmeldetechnisches Zentralamt der Deutschen Bundespost) in Darmstadt have found indications which raise some suspecions as to the damaging side-effects of gold-flashing. For this reason, a working committee of the VDE (Association of German Electrical Engineers), group 1.6„Contact behaviour and switching processes“, undertook its own investigations. The results were revealed during a platform-discussion on the 3rd October, 1973 in the Technical College at Karlsruhe and are given here in the form of edited speeches and a summary of the discussion.

    Notes: Summary The vascularization of the parietal-temporal region of the cerebral hemispheres has been studied in a total of 50 rats from day 11 of gestation up to adults. The first extracerebral vessels constituting the primary perineural vascular network and the first intracerebral vessels on day 12–14 of gestation show sinusoid characteristics, i.e. irregular thickness of the endothelial wall perforated by fenestrations or small holes and showing, if at all, the beginning accumulation of basement membrane (BM) material. No paired vessels have been observed which would be expected if internal vascularization of cortical anlage starts by penetrating loops. Immature capillaries developing by sprouting (and) from the preexistent vessels begin to appear at about day 15 of gestation. The further differentiation of the terminal vascular bed and the establishing of the definitive architecture is accompanied by the maturation of cortical tissue, i.e. diminution of extracellular spaces, differentiation of perivascular, astroglial and neuronal elements including the development of synapses. The continuous process of BM-formation from the first appearance until the postnatal thickening is described by four successive stages: Stage 1. Local accumulations of fine filamentous material between endothelium and opposite perivascular surfaces of sinusoids and sprouts. Stage 2. Delicate networks of filaments attached on endothelial, pericytal and adjacent glial plasma membranes (PM) of immature capillaries, plaques of lamina densa in narrow perivascular clefts. Stage 3. A thin continuous lamina densa adapted to the PM; its filaments are arranged parallel to the cell surface. In this plane they run randomly. In the lamina rara only few filaments run to the PM mainly perpendicular: stage of immature cortical capillaries. Stage 4. Thickened lamina densa, condensed filamentous pattern; narrow zone of lamina rara: stage of mature cortical capillaries. Coincidental with the rapid thickening of BM in the 3rd–4th postnatal week the characteristics of capillary growth change: The intensive sprouting is finished and the capillary length increases nearly proportionally to tissue volume later on. It is suggested that the BM plays a role in regulating differentiation and mitotic division of the adjacent cells.

    Description / Table of Contents: Contributions to the Chemistry of Phosphorus. 53. 1,2,3,4-Tetraphenylcyclo-5-thia-1,2,3,4-tetraphosphane1,2,3,4-Tetraphenyl-cyclo-5-thia-1,2,3,4-tetraphosphane (“tetraphenylcyclotetraphosphine-monosulphide„) 1 is obtained in very good yield and purity by the reaction of pentaphenyl-cyclopentaphosphane (2) with sulphur (4 C6H5P: 1 S). Further new methods of preparation are the comproportionation of 2 with (C6H5PS)3, and the reaction of dipotassium-triphenyl-cyclotriphosphide (4) with sulphur dichloride. The IR and 31P-NMR spectra of the title compound indicate unambiguously the heterocyclophosphane structure 1 with a five-membered P4S ring. The elevated stability of this ring system is evident from numerous other formation reactions, which are reported in addition.

    Description / Table of Contents: Contributions to the Chemistry of Hydrazine and its Derivatives. XXXVI. On the Pernitrides and Nitrogen Complexes of Barium, Strontium, and CalciumFor further characterization of the alkaline earth pernitrides M3N4 (M = Ba, Sr, Ca) as well as the alkaline earth-nitrogen complexes, which can be obtained from them, magnetical studies were carried out. Whereas barium and calcium pernitride show paramagnetism and strontium pernitride weak diamagnetism, the nitrogen complexes are diamagnetic. The barium-nitrogen complex was treated with carbon monoxide under high pressures at different temperatures. Although no exact ligand exchange occurred, a partial addition of the CO molecule was noticed. By reaction of barium pernitride with carbon monoxide at 250°C and 450 at barium cyanide was produced in high yield.

    Description / Table of Contents: Hexakis(trifluorophosphine) Complexes of Chromium(0), Molybdenum(0), and Tungsten(0)The reaction of tris(π-allyl)chromium with PF3 at low pressure yields deep darkgreen tris(π-allyl)-trifluorophosphine chromium which is slowly converted into hexakis(trifluorophosphine) chromium: If tris(π-allyl)chromium is reacted with PF3 at high pressure, the only isolable product is Cr(PF3)6. Anhydrous molybdenum(V) and tungsten(VI) chloride react with PF3 in the presence of copper to the hexakis(trifluorophosphine) complexes of the zerovalent metals: The hexakis(trifluorophosphine) complexes are thermally very stable, crystalline, colourless solids.
